Dominic feels homesick, until he's finally told who he truly is.

"

            It had been days since he left his home town and the girl that he loved. He missed her more than he missed anything else in the world. Alex Wolfe still had told him nothing of his parents. They passed through towns and many times he would see a nice gentlement thinking it was his father and neither time it was. Now he was heading to Asyanara the home of the King Maric. It was the biggest and richest town in the world. He’d always wanted to visit. He hoped his father lived here.

            He watched as the huge massive stone gate raised from the ground. He could seet the stone wall stretching as far as his eyes could see. The carriage began rolling inside. He kept switching from left to right in his seat checking out the views. From his left he could see the numerous roads that stretched out far. He could see the villagers homes and all looked in mint condition. The villagers themselves that he could see appeared happy. The view on his left looked like merchant shops he could hear the many sellers shouting out products and prices. Further on down the road it seemed like a mix of what he’d just seen there wasn’t any particular pattern which just confused him. He just sat back until he passed the area. He glimpsed his head out again and saw a winding road. He tried to stretch his eyes even further and it was an endless field. There were some houses and farms on the path as the carriage went further. When he got to the inner circle he could finally see the end of the path led to a huge castle.

            When the carriage finally pulled up the castle Dominic didn’t know what to think. He watched Alex get out and then gesture for him too. Dominic climbed out unsure of what to think. The castle ground was massive. It seemed like an entire mini town and he thought it was because the outskirts of the castle had many houses. He turned around and could see the giant blankets of emerald green grass. He saw the place had a barn filled with horses roaming a fenced in yard. There were many carriages lined up by the road definitely better than the one he just rode in he was sure of it. The castle looked huge. He couldn’t get a very good glimpse of it once he saw Alex was entering the doors. All he could see was that it was a tall stone structure filled with many windows and floors. He walked through the doors of the castle and stopped.

            “Does my father work here?” He asked Alex who was already attempting to walk down a hallway.

            “Yes your father has been here since he was born.” Alex said very coyly.

            Great, Dominic thought. My father is a servant, but he’s a servant to the king. Dominic figured that is how he must’ve paid for his transportation. He followed Alex down the hallway. He wondered if Alex brought him here if he was going to become a servant. He hoped that wasn’t the case. He followed Alex down a few more hallways and wondered if they were heading to the servant quarters considering how long it was taking them to get there. Finally he saw Alex head toward two doors with soldiers at them. The soldiers glanced at Alex and opened the doors. Dominic followed him in.

            The room was a personal one he could see a big window with white drapes around it. He could see the walls were painted brightly and loud. It all screamed for attention he thought. He turned and his heart dropped. He saw a man around Alex’s age looking at him. The man looked familiar to him. He knew him immediately as his father. The man looked just like him tan skin, brown eyes, and short brown hair.

            “Dad”, Dominic said walking toward him.

            “Yes”, the man said. Dominic eyes became watery. He was overcome with emotions. He was a little confused though. His father wasn’t dressed like a servant. Although two soldiers were guarding him in this room making Dominic wonder if his father were a criminal.

            “Dad”, Dominic said running up to him and giving him a hug. Dominic didn’t know why he didn’t hate him anymore. He just was so glad that he was here. He held onto his father he hadn’t realized anyone else was in the room until he opened his eyes and saw her.

            She was extraordinarily beautiful. Her blond hair was all wrapped up in a bun. She wore a magnificent white and silver dress with jewels around her nick and hands. She looked like a million bucks. He could see her brown eyes were crying. “My baby boy”, she said while Dominic released himself from his father to hug her.

            This was his mother this was his family. He just held them both. The moment was only seconds, but felt like the world stopped just for them. Then suddenly a knock at the door snapped them out of it. A soldier emerged from the doorway “my lord there is a disturbance at Reed Way. How should we proceed?” Dominic didn’t understand why the man was looking at his father.

            “Take some men and dispurse it at once. Tell them they know the law and the law will be upheld if they refuse.” His fathers demeanor changed rather quickly from soft to hard and then soft again when he looked at Dominic.

            “Are you a lord?” Dominic asked confused he was sure his father was no longer a servant, but that was all he gathered.

            “I am called that sometimes.” He said looking toward Dominic with a smile. “Walk with me toward the window”, he said leading the way. “Do you see all the people down there?”

            Dominic was surprised that he could see nearly the entire village down to the gates he first entered on. Of course everyone appeared like a tiny dot, but he could see them all right. He nodded to his father.

            “One day they will call you a lord too.”

            “Me, why”, Dominic said still not understanding.

            “You’re my son. The son of a king.” His father said walking over to his wife. “You are Dominic Asyanara.”

            Dominic took a backed away from the window. He couldn’t believe that he was Dominic Asyanara. That would make him the son of King Maric and Queen Amilia he looked up at that. He looked toward Alex Wolfe who was standing near the door.

            “My most trusted lieutenant”, King Maric said. He walked over to Dominic who was not adjusting. “I know it will take time for you. In the meantime I am pretty sure your hungry.” He said leading him out the doors.
